§ 29.922 — TEXAS WORKFORCE INNOVATION NEEDS PROGRAM

ED § 29.922Title 2. PUBLIC EDUCATION · Part F. CURRICULUM, PROGRAMS, AND SERVICES · Ch. 29. EDUCATIONAL PROGRAMS · Art. Z. MISCELLANEOUS PROGRAMS

Statute text

View on source
(a)In this section:
(1)"Private or independent institution of higher education" has the meaning assigned by Section 61.003.
(2)"Program" means the Texas Workforce Innovation Needs Program.
(b)The Texas Workforce Innovation Needs Program is established to:
(1)provide selected school districts, public institutions of higher education, and private or independent institutions of higher education with the opportunity to establish innovative programs designed to prepare students for careers for which there is demand in this state; and
(2)use the results of those programs to inform the governor, legislature, and commissioner concerning methods for transforming public education and higher education in this state by improving student learning and career preparedness.

Legislative history

Added by Acts 2013, 83rd Leg., R.S., Ch. 215 (H.B. 3662), Sec. 1, eff. June 10, 2013.
